Although the surname Gnanou is relatively rare, it can be found in several countries around the world. According to data, the highest incidence of the surname Gnanou is in Burkina Faso, with a total of 8753 individuals bearing the name. This is followed by Togo, with 945 individuals, and Côte d'Ivoire, with 557 individuals.
Other countries where the surname Gnanou can be found include Benin, France, the United States, India, Ghana, Belgium, Cameroon, Libya, Namibia, Russia, Saudi Arabia, and South Africa.
